Royal Expert Weighs In On Whether Cambridges Should Stay With Meghan And Harry
Should the Fab Four reunite at Meghan and Harry’s Montecito abode? Kate and William are headed to the United States so that Prince William can receive The Earthshot Prize. This is for his environmental initiatives.
There are rumors that the Cambridges will be staying at the Southern California home during their stay. Although the Palace has not confirmed it, there has been one royal expert who has a strong opinion on this possibility.
According to an exclusive interview with US Magazine, royal expert, Jonathan Sacerdoti, revealed that this situation will produce a cornucopia of situations that are difficult. He explained, “It’s like so many of these things — it’s a sort of lose-lose situation.”

Sacerdoti then listed the myriad of possibilities. “If they get invited and they decline, it seems petty and nasty. And if they don’t get invited, it seems petty and nasty from the other side. And if they do accept such an invitation and something goes terribly wrong, that seems like a bad idea. I can’t quite see how this would work.”
Meghan And Harry Moved To California In 2020
Nearly two years ago, during March 2020, the Sussexes left Royal life in England and headed to Meghan’s native California. That was right after the uncomfortable Commonwealth Day Service at Westminster Abbey in London. This is when the Fab Four last were publicly together.
Since then, a lot has happened. Their grandfather, Prince Philip died in April. Harry came solo for the funeral. That is because the former Suits star was pregnant. Then, Meghan and Harry became parents to Lilibet last June.
Lastly, Harry made another solo trip to England in July. This was for the unveiling of the Princess Diana statute, for what would have been her 60th birthday.
